POWER SUPPLY

Condition and attention:

• When RECHARGEABLE BATTERY PACK battery is low, player will stop playing.
• During the playback, if the battery is low, the BATTERY LOW indicator on the unit front panel will turns into red and

blink. At this time, please recharge the battery.

• Do not short-circuit the terminals.
• Use only the supplied AC ADAPTOR and BATTERY CHARGER to recharge the rechargeable battery pack.
• Detach the battery pack. (Even if the unit is off, it still uses some power. This can lead to over discharging of the

battery and malfunction.)

• Recharge the battery pack when you are ready to use it again.
• If the rechargeable battery pack is not to be used for a long period of time, discharge it and store it in a place that

is cool, dry and dark.

• While using the rechargeable battery pack, the environmental temperature should be 5°C (41°F) to 35°C (95°F).
• To undertake the longest service life of the rechargeable battery pack, charge it under or close to indoor-

temperature.

• Never dispose of in fire, water or heat up.
• Do not open the rechargeable battery pack, refer servicing only to qualified service personnel.

Turning on the unit

1. Slide the POWER ON/OFF button to on position on the left side of unit.
2. Slide the FUNCTION button to DVD or AV IN mode on right side of unit.

• If you select DVD the DVD logo (start-up picture) will appear on unit screen.
